How does a liquid manure spreader contribute to farming?

Explanation:
A liquid manure spreader is a crucial tool in modern farming, specifically in the context of nutrient management and soil fertility. Its primary role is to effectively distribute liquid manure across fields, which is rich in essential nutrients such as nitrogen, phosphorus, and potassium. By enhancing soil fertility through even distribution of manure, the spreader ensures that crops receive the necessary nutrients they require for optimal growth, leading to improved crop yields and soil health. The spreading process helps to incorporate the nutrients into the soil, where they can be readily absorbed by plant roots. This method of fertilization not only enriches the soil but also supports sustainable farming practices by recycling animal waste as a valuable resource. This has ecological benefits as well, as it reduces the need for synthetic fertilizers, which can have harmful environmental impacts. A Fertilizer That Works with Nature

At its core, a liquid manure spreader does one thing exceptionally well—it enhances soil fertility through an even distribution of manure. Think of it as an organic liquid fertilizer, rich in essential nutrients like nitrogen, phosphorus, and potassium. By utilizing this method of fertilization, farmers are able to coat their fields evenly, ensuring that crops receive all the nourishment they need for optimal growth. Sweet Soil Health

The spreading process is where the real magic happens. When liquid manure is applied to the fields, it doesn’t just sit on top; it works its way into the soil. This incorporation process allows vital nutrients to reach plant roots more effectively, boosting their uptake capabilities. It’s like giving crops a superfood buffet! Plus, it contributes significantly to soil health, making it more resilient and fertile over time.

The Eco-Friendly Choice

Now, let’s talk about sustainability. Unlike synthetic fertilizers, which can sometimes come with harmful environmental impacts—such as runoff leading to water pollution—liquid manure is a form of recycling at its finest. Here’s the thing: by using animal waste as a resource, farmers can reduce their dependence on chemical fertilizers while also improving soil conditions. It’s a win-win for nature and agriculture!
